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90535756 12255219783 852209469 84966263
61 594 0099976
61 594 0099976
7038770594 536 84
All about undefined
Interested in learning more?
61 594 0099976
7038770594 536 84
See more
78 378
7901282 927872 122
See more
7824759735 4105108333 585
48618 16 5015220195
See more